 Daniel Bauer - Ph.D. StudentE-mail: bauerx[at]xcs.columbia.edu Home Page: www.cs.columbia.edu/~bauer
My research interests are in natural language understanding,
focusing on semantic interpretation. My work uses formal methods that
combine syntactic parsing, semantic parsing, knowledge representation,
and inference to make NLP systems more aware of real world context and
background knowledge. As one possible application for this I work on
interpreting descriptions of visual scenes and automatically
converting textual descriptions into 3D scenes. Although physically
located in the SpeechLab, I am a student of Owen Rambow at the Center for Computational Learning
Systems.
